Overview
The drivers of exotic supercars put their street cred on the line against deceptively fast sleeper cars built and modified by true gearheads.
The drivers of exotic supercars put their street cred on the line against deceptively fast sleeper cars built and modified by true gearheads.
Login to add a comment
No comments yet